The Comparison
π is significantly more recognizable and widely used across platforms for expressing agreement, positivity, or ironic calm, giving it far greater cultural reach than the niche π§ββ‘οΈ emoji.
π§ββ‘οΈ depicts a person kneeling and moving/facing to the right, suggesting motion or direction,
Officialπ shows a person raising both arms in an 'OK' or celebratory gesture above their head.
π§ββ‘οΈ is rarely used by Gen Z except in niche meme or roleplay contexts, whereas π occasionally appears to signal 'everything's fine' or ironically to say things are definitely NOT fine.
Genzπ§ββ‘οΈ can convey submission, defeat, or crawling forward emotionally,
Emotionalπ reads as acceptance, approval, or a relaxed 'all good' emotional tone.
π§ββ‘οΈ might humorously imply someone is crawling back to an ex or proposing in a weird way,
Datingπ is used to signal openness, chill vibes, or enthusiastic agreement on a date plan.
π§ββ‘οΈ is a niche meme emoji used in absurdist or walking/crawling humor formats,
Memeπ appears in 'this is fine' irony memes or celebratory reaction memes.
π§ββ‘οΈ gets used in TikTok comment sections for comedic crawling-away or surrendering moments,
Tiktokπ is used to hype up content or sarcastically express forced calm.
π§ββ‘οΈ is rarely sent in WhatsApp chats due to its obscure meaning,
Whatsappπ is more commonly used to quickly affirm plans or signal that everything is okay in group chats.
Use π§ββ‘οΈ when you want to humorously depict crawling away, submission, or absurd movement-based storytelling in memes or roleplay. Use π when you want to quickly signal approval, agreement, or a breezy 'all good' vibe in everyday conversations. π is the safer, more universally understood choice for casual digital communication.
